FC-8.3-P
Oven Cleaner
Ingredients
| Ingredient | INCI / Description | % w/w | Function | Addition Order |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Deionized water | Aqua | 55.0 | Solvent | 1 |
| Sodium hydroxide (50%) | Sodium hydroxide | 10.0 | Strong alkali, carbonized grease saponification | 2 |
| Sodium metasilicate pentahydrate | Sodium metasilicate | 5.0 | Buffer, corrosion inhibitor, anti-redeposition | 3 |
| Nonionic surfactant (C12–14, 7 EO) | C12-14 pareth-7 | 3.0 | Wetting and penetration agent | 4 |
| 2-Butoxyethanol | 2-Butoxyethanol | 5.0 | Solvent for polymerized grease | 5 |
| Xanthan gum | Xanthan gum | 1.2 | Primary thixotropic thickener | 6 |
| Colloidal magnesium aluminum silicate | Magnesium aluminum silicate | 0.8 | Secondary thickener, structure builder | 7 |
| Paraffin wax emulsion | Paraffin | 2.0 | Opacity agent, additional cling | 8 |
| Sodium xylene sulfonate (40%) | Sodium xylene sulfonate | 2.0 | Hydrotrope | 9 |
| Fragrance | Fragrance (parfum) | 0.3 | Odor masking | 10 |
| Colorant | CI 16185 | 0.01 | Visibility on surface | 11 |
| Total | ~100 |

Formulation Notes
Oven cleaners represent the most aggressive formulation class in kitchen cleaning. Carbonized grease and pyrolyzed food residues require both strong alkali (NaOH at 3–5% active) and elevated contact time. Because oven walls, roofs, and doors are vertical or overhead, the formulation must exhibit thixotropic behavior—low viscosity under shear (for pump sprayability) but high viscosity at rest (for cling and extended contact) .
Formulation Card FC-8.3-P: Oven Cleaner (Thixotropic Cling Formula)
Properties: pH 13.0–13.8 (as is); Brookfield viscosity 3,000–8,000 cP at 1 rpm; density 1.06–1.10 g/mL. Contact time: 5–30 min depending on soil severity. Safety: Corrosive—causes severe skin burns and eye damage. Do not inhale mist. Wear impervious gloves, face shield, and chemical-resistant apron. Do not use on self-cleaning oven coatings, aluminum, or painted surfaces.
Notes: Sodium metasilicate at 5% serves a dual function: it buffers the pH above 12.5 even as NaOH is consumed by saponification reactions, and it inhibits corrosion on steel oven components by forming a passive silicate film. The thixotropic system of xanthan gum plus colloidal silicate provides shear-thinning behavior essential for aerosol or trigger-spray application followed by vertical cling. Paraffin wax emulsion improves visibility of the applied product on dark oven surfaces and contributes a water-repellent film that aids post-cleaning rinsing. Formulations of this pH must carry the GHS hazard pictograms for corrosion (GHS05) and be packaged in high-density polyethylene (HDPE) containers with child-resistant closures.
